Transaction 21f625f81ad631a08de03af6fc1faef12161a05626e2778a8c948104aec8376a
1 Input
1 Output
-
21f625f81ad631a08de03af6fc1faef12161a05626e2778a8c948104aec8376a:0
- value
- 52530
- script pubkey
- OP_0 OP_PUSHBYTES_20 7c6b171d1b4f04e94f31058ca3dca10e617e2bdf
- address
- bc1q0343w8gmfuzwjne3qkx28h9ppeshu27lq6tdek